The Clinical Safeguard: How to Efficiently Review, Edit, and Sign Off on AI-Generated Notes

Busy SLPs know the frustration of spending more time on documentation than on therapy. AI‑generated notes promise speed, but they often arrive with vague phrasing, missing data, or compliance risks. A structured safeguard lets you reclaim those minutes without sacrificing quality.

The RED‑GREEN Review Framework

Treat every AI draft as a worksheet: mark Red for anything that must be deleted or rewritten (clinical inaccuracy, generic jargon), and Green for content that is accurate and ready to sign. The goal is to transform the draft into a note that reflects your skilled intervention, includes measurable outcomes, and satisfies payer and HIPAA requirements.

Mini‑Scenario

You receive an AI note that reads, “Continued therapy is needed to improve functional communication.” You flag it as Red because it lacks specificity, then rewrite it to note the exact strategy you used and the client’s response.

Implementation: Three High‑Level Steps

  1. Rapid Scan for Red Flags – Look for vague phrases like “He was engaged” or “Will continue to target goals.” Replace them with concrete observations such as “Leo maintained attention for 20 minutes of the structured activity” and specify the next therapeutic step.
  2. Enhance with Clinical Detail – Insert your skilled intervention (e.g., “I used focused modeling and a sentence‑strip visual scaffold to expand his 2‑word productions”), verify quantitative data (accuracy rose from 50% to 70%), and add functional impact (“This deficit impacts his ability to order food independently in the cafeteria”). Also confirm parent involvement and insurance keywords (e.g., “pacing strategy,” “measurable progress”).
  3. Final Safety Check – Verify client name, date, and session length; run a HIPAA privacy check to ensure no inadvertent identifiers; confirm the note is formatted per your clinic’s template; then sign off, knowing the Green sections are audit‑ready.

Conclusion

By applying the RED‑GREEN framework—identifying what to delete, enriching with your expertise, and completing a quick compliance sweep—you turn AI‑generated drafts into precise, reimbursable notes in a fraction of the usual time, freeing you to focus on what matters most: your clients’ progress.
